Chapter 39: This Guy Wants to Go to Your Place
The real reason Hayato gave the [Man-Eater Bug] to Yugi was, of course, not what he told Yugi. That was just an excuse to get him to accept it. This goes back to when Hayato bought that [Custom Booster Pack] that he still regrets to this day.
The description of that Booster Pack clearly stated that all the Cards in the Card Box could be added to Hayato's existing Card Pool, and there was a guaranteed minimum of 1 UR-Rank, 3 SR-Rank rare Cards, and all 100 Card Packs had an R Grade guarantee.
This meant that no matter how bad Hayato's luck was, he could at least pull 100 R Grade Cards, 3 SR-Rank, and one UR-Rank, and they would all be types that could be added to his own Card Pool. He wouldn't end up with a bunch of Chaos Soldier support Cards if he was playing a Harpie Deck.
Hayato originally thought so too, but what he never expected was that the most valuable point, "Supplement Cards based on the current Card Pool," turned out to be the biggest trap. Because the Card Packs were based not on the "Deck," but on the Card Pool.
When he bought the Card Packs, the most abundant component in Hayato's Deck was Warrior Type Monsters, followed by four Dragon Type Monsters and the Ojama Brothers. The most common Monster Attribute was "Earth."
Therefore, the first Card Pack Hayato opened contained an extremely powerful SR-Rank Card—[Grandsoil the Elemental Lord].
[Grandsoil the Elemental Lord] [8☆/Earth] [Beast-Warrior Type/Effect] [2800/2200]
Although this Monster with decent Stats had restrictions like "Cannot be Normal Summoned" and "Can only be Special Summoned when there are exactly 5 Earth Attribute Monsters in the Graveyard," and a Negative Effect of "Skip your next Battle Phase" after leaving the Field, its first Effect was powerful enough—
Revive one Monster from your or your opponent's Graveyard to your Field, which is the Monster Effect version of [Monster Reborn].
Drawing such a Card, and as a good start, Hayato was naturally quite happy. But immediately starting from the second Card Pack, the smile on his face disappeared.
He opened thirty Card Packs in one go, and the R Grade guaranteed Cards inside were without exception, all Earth Attribute Normal Monsters, ranging from Insect, Warrior Type, to Machine, Rock Type, and even a few Dragon Type.
The only thing that gave Hayato some comfort was that in the thirty-first pack, a Card he had been eyeing before finally appeared—[Gaia the Dragon Champion].
Although it was just a Normal Fusion Monster, this was the first Fusion Monster Card Hayato had obtained so far, and it was a Dragon Type Monster. The [Dragon Mirror] he had left gathering dust in his Warehouse for a long time finally had a use.
The subsequent Card Packs followed a pattern of one good, one bad. In the end, Hayato ended up Converting about fifty Cards from the pile he opened, only getting back 500 DP. However, the remaining Cards weren't all useless. The [Megamorph] Hayato had used before and the [Man-Eater Bug] he gave to Yugi were the two UR-Rank Cards he pulled.
Although he pulled two UR-Rank Cards despite only being guaranteed one, the number of SR-Rank Cards was exactly ten, not one more. Besides [Gaia the Dragon Champion] and [Grandsoil the Elemental Lord], there were also several Generic Support Cards for Warrior Type, and an [Ojama Country] that could be used in an [Ojama] Deck. It's worth mentioning that the System classified the [Fusion] Spell Card as SR Grade, and Hayato also pulled one this time.
When Hayato opened his fortieth Card Pack, he remembered that he still had a Quest to "Collect R Grade or higher Cards." After claiming the 1000 DP reward, the [Quests] refreshed, and a new Quest appeared—
[This Guy Wants to Go to Your Place]
Gift a Card of UR Grade or higher rarity to someone else.
Reward: 1000 DP, a random [Kuriboh] series Card.
After claiming the reward for completing this Quest from the System, Hayato didn't check which [Kuriboh] he randomly received. After confirming that his DP was now back to 4500, he looked at the figure on the Television.
"So, shall we continue the topic we were interrupted on, Mr. Pegasus? What do you think of my previous suggestions?" He shook the glass of soda in his hand as if swirling a wine glass, but realizing that this action would only accelerate the escape of bubbles, he immediately put the glass back down.
"Oh Hayato boy~, honestly, I am truly amazed by the novel Ideas in your mind." The Television Hayato was currently watching was clearly just a pre-recorded Videotape, but Pegasus in the image spoke as if in a Video Call with Hayato, "Continuous Spell Cards, Equip and Field, and Quick-Play Spell Cards that reflect Spell Speed."
"What surprised me the most is the 'Trap Card' you came up with. I always felt that Duel Monsters was missing something, and that is the existence of Traps! Interference with the opponent and counterattacks against interference, the appearance of Traps will make Duel Monsters more Tactical Nature, truly Subarashii!"
"However, the realization of Ideas requires more than just thoughts. On one hand, I am excited by your novel Ideas, Hayato boy, and on the other hand, I am troubled by the Inspiration for designing Trap Cards. It's quite a dilemma~"
Saying this, Pegasus in the image even pretended to cover his head, looking troubled.
"Although the early work is hard, thinking about how much more interesting Duel Monsters will become, I'm sure Mr. Pegasus, you are also looking forward to how the future will turn out, right?" Hayato said with a smile, "As for designing Cards? I wouldn't doubt your title of 'Father of Duel Monsters' for a moment."
"It's truly interesting chatting with you, Hayato boy~" Pegasus in the image smiled elegantly, "Originally, I just sent this Gift out of curiosity, but I didn't expect to encounter such a big surprise. Are you interested in joining Industrial Illusions? I can offer you a High Salary~"
"Although I'd love to accept, my interest is more in using Cards than designing them. Besides, I've studied Duel Monsters for a long time to come up with just these few Ideas. Even if you tempt me with a High Salary, I don't have much more to be squeezed out, Mr. Pegasus."
"Providing me with such ingenious Ideas for free, it's clear you are also someone who truly loves the game, Hayato boy~" Pegasus looked at Hayato and nodded with satisfaction, "Is there any Wish you want to fulfill? My Industrial Illusions still has some financial resources, you know?"
Hayato smiled: "Mr. Pegasus, you are truly amazing, it's almost like you have the Mind Reading Ability. I just happen to have one thing I'd like to ask for your help with."
"I heard from someone I know, do you have a 'Duelist Kingdom' Project?"
